How you can dig up configuration particulars in your Linux system with getconf

13.08.2021 Admin

Linux techniques can report on much more configuration particulars than you possible ever knew have been accessible. The trick is utilizing the getconf command and having an concept what you might be on the lookout for. Be careful although. You would possibly end up a bit overwhelmed with what number of settings can be found.

To start out, let us take a look at a couple of settings that you simply may need anticipated to see to reply  some necessary questions.

For starters, how lengthy can a filename be?

The intent of Cloud Paks is to supply a pre-configured, containerized and examined answer that's licensed by IBM. This strategy is supposed to eradicate lots of the unknowns in deploying workloads within the cloud. Whereas we expect it is a nice strategy to simplification, there's nonetheless a major quantity of customization that must be made for every occasion of the answer that can be distinctive to a person group’s wants. As such, a good portion of the Cloud Pak deployment should be customized applied by IBM providers. That in and of itself isn't essentially an issue, however it does imply that this isn't a easy “off the shelf” answer that may be applied simply by inside IT staffs in most organizations.

You’ll be able to verify this setting by wanting on the NAME_MAX setting.

“IT professionals working for a smaller group or a corporation that doesn’t should adjust to governmental rules could possibly present affordable hybrid cloud options to the group with simply their private experience and a few analysis into what most closely fits the enterprise focus. Nonetheless, bigger, enterprise-sized organizations might profit from IT professionals having certifications that concentrate on their specific wants,” Williams says.
As an example, if a corporation has roles similar to database managers, builders, data safety managers, and community architects, then it's a prime candidate for coaching and certification. “If the enterprise is giant sufficient to require such a specialised function from its IT assist folks, it could be helpful and even required that personnel in these roles are licensed in hybrid cloud environments,” she says.

The “x” on the finish of the above command appears essential to keep away from an error (unsure why). You too can use the command proven beneath to see the worth. The -a causes getconf to point out all settings and the grep command then selects any settings that begin with “NAME_MAX”.

 

Ceridian's future cloud plans are each pragmatic and forward-looking: "Proceed to benefit from the most recent, newest, and best applied sciences," Perlman says.
That features cloud capabilities akin to autoscalability with redundancy and failover that is in-built natively, together with the power emigrate between cloud suppliers to make sure optimum availability, which interprets into 99.999% uptime. "You may have an Azure-AWS active-type state of affairs the place you may failover from one mega-cloud supplier to the opposite so that you just actually, actually get to a five-nines structure," Perlman says.

 

Is your system a 32- or a 64-bit system?

What number of processes can a person run without delay?

That is the utmost variety of simultaneous processes allowed per person ID. The processes clearly can not use the CPU on the similar time, however that is the quantity that may be lively.

How lengthy can usernames be?

Care to verify this out? When you create a really lengthy username like that proven beneath, you do not run into any issues.

I am unable to think about anybody prepared to kind wherever close to 256 characters to log in. Nonetheless, this reveals that usernames could be ridiculously lengthy if you happen to want them to be.

If you wish to checklist the entire accessible configuration particulars, be ready. It consists of 320 settings.

Here is what the start of the checklist seems to be like with a few of the settings briefly defined:

One comparatively simple approach to get began with getconf is to pick settings from the checklist utilizing grep. Listed below are all of the settings that embody “NAME” of their names:

Among the settings which can be in all probability probably the most related to Linux customers are the maximums outlined for numerous issues just like the file-name most size. Contemplating the settings, I doubt that I do know anybody has ever pushed residence grumbling that he could not create a file with a reputation that included greater than 255 characters. And can the system let you know if you happen to exceed that restrict? You guess it’ll. Here is a take a look at:

One extra character put us over the restrict within the second contact command proven above.

To checklist all of the setting with “MAX” of their names, run a command like this one:

The one actually massive setting close to the underside, ULONG_MAX, is the utmost worth for an object of kind unsigned lengthy int.

Figuring out what every of the 84 MAX settings truly represents is prone to take a while. Some are described in information just like the limits.h file proven beneath.

The limits.h file is supposed to be informative and can’t be used to alter setting values.

Probably the most fascinating issues concerning the getconf command’s output is exhibiting how beneficiant many of the settings truly are and what number of issues on Linux techniques have limits imposed.

You may also concern: